How Paylines Actually Work

A traditional payline runs left to right across the reels, one symbol deep per reel. Three matching symbols on that line trigger a payout based on the machine’s paytable. Older pokies often had just one to five fixed lines, which meant every spin had a clear, predictable cost.

Video slots changed the maths entirely. A five-reel game with three rows can theoretically support 243 distinct paths (3×3×3×3×3), and most of these „ways“ machines pay for matching symbols in any position on consecutive reels rather than on a single drawn line. Scatter symbols typically ignore paylines altogether, paying from any position on the screen.

The number of active lines directly affects your stake. On a 25-line game with a $0.01 coin, playing all lines costs $0.25 per spin. Reducing active lines lowers the cost but also removes potential winning paths , a trade-off many casual players underestimate.

Fixed vs Adjustable Lines: What It Means for Your Bankroll

Some machines lock all paylines on. Others let you choose. Adjustable-line slots suit low-budget sessions, but they dilute payout potential because most games are mathematically tuned for maximum lines active. Industry data suggests RTP figures published by regulators, commonly between 94% and 97%, assume full-line play.

Fixed-line games remove that decision. You always know the cost per spin, and the paytable stays consistent. For players who prefer simple budgeting, fixed-line pokies are usually the safer choice.

Bet sizing matters just as much as line count. A 20-line game at $0.05 per line equals $1.00 per spin. The same game at $0.01 per line costs $0.20. Over 500 spins, that difference is $400 versus $80 , a gap that shapes how long your session lasts.

Reading the Paytable Before You Spin

Every regulated pokies site publishes a paytable listing symbol values, line requirements, and special features. Checking it takes under a minute and reveals volatility, maximum win caps, and whether wilds substitute across all lines or only specific ones.

Wild symbols usually complete winning combinations on any active payline, while expanding wilds cover entire reels. Bonus rounds may award free spins with a fixed line count, often higher than the base game.

Practical habits help: confirm the line count, note the minimum and maximum bet, and check whether scatters pay in both directions. Players who review these details consistently report fewer surprises and better bankroll control across sessions.
